Always clean your shears after every use. A single drop of oil on the pivot screw will keep the tension smooth and prevent the metal from corroding.

Pro Tip: Always brush your dog thoroughly before clipping. Trying to run a clipper through a mat can be painful for the dog and will quickly dull your expensive blades.
Start with a clean, dry dog. Dirt and grit in the fur act like sandpaper on your tools. Use a high-quality shampoo and ensure the coat is 100% dry before you pick up your clippers.
Use your Dog Grooming Clippers to remove the bulk of the length. Work with the direction of hair growth (with the grain) to avoid "clipper burn" or uneven tracks.
Switch to your grooming scissors for dog for the "finishing touches." Carefully trim around the eyes, the "sanitary" areas, and the paw pads. Use curved shears to give the legs and tail a polished, rounded appearance.
Grooming should be a positive experience. Offer treats and praise throughout the process to build trust.
